Ha. We are slightly rural (about 10 mins outside perimeter). We have DSL or cellular or satellite as our net options. The costs are insane for slow, spotty net service (max 10mbs down but really more like 1-2 with a 100 gb monthly data cap at $100 per month.) We actually got our RM to do a feasibility study on community owned fiber.
